Pulmonary interstitium

Pulmonary interstitium is a collection of support tissues within the lung that incluces the alveolar epithelium, pulmonary capillary endothelium, basement membrane, perivascular and perilymphatic tissues.

The pulmonary interstitium can be divided into three zones 1,2. In interstitial lung disease, some diseases affect all zones while others have a predeliction to affect a particular pulmonary interstitial zone: 2
